I have four day old araucana chicks and have been feeding them Ace Hi chick starter mash. I was wondering if it's okay to mix Purina start & grow with it. I wasn't sure if that would be too much, or if it would provide them a beet balanced diet. If anyone has any information it would be greatly appreciated. Thanks.smile.png
post #2 of 7

They both appear to be Chick Starter/grower, so there would be no harm and no particular advantage either.  idunno.gif

Why do you want to mix the two?

From what I see the Ace High feed looks to be a better feed, plus it has meat and bone meal in it something Purina doesn't have.
